MLC-SLM Challenge: New methods boost multilingual speech tasks

Researchers have developed novel methods for the second MLC-SLM Challenge, focusing on multilingual conversational speech tasks. For speaker diarization and recognition, they fine-tuned the VibeVoice-ASR-7B model using techniques like random leading-silence cropping and an exponential moving average strategy, which improved performance by reducing tcpMER. For conversational speech understanding, they created synthetic question-answer pairs and fine-tuned the Qwen3-Omni-30B-A3B-Instruct model, achieving a notable accuracy increase. AI
